Foreign Language Club (FLC) is hosting a field trip to the Melting Pot Restaurant in Downers Grove on Monday, February 29 starting at 5:45 p.m.

Foreign Language Club gives students the opportunity to attend multicultural events. The events allow them to apply their knowledge from taking a language in school and learning new things about the world around them.

One of the annual main events is the Melting Pot. Mrs. Ercoli, the FLC sponsor, expressed her excitement for the trip by saying, “The Melting Pot is a very nice restaurant, which is kind of funny because fondue started out as more of a peasant dish to use up stale bread and cheese scraps.  It’s considered the national dish of Switzerland, which fits our club’s cultural mission.”

This event will allow students to try an arrangement of different foods which includes: cheese appetizer fondue, house salad, chocolate dessert fondue, and a Signature Selection entree which is an assortment of meat, poultry, shrimp and vegetables all cooked in bouillon.
